This highly reliable and accurate water logger records 6,000 readings and is programmable from one reading per second to one reading per hour. Ranges of 0-3', 0-15', 0-30', 0-60', 0-120' and 0-250' are available. A 25' cable is standard, with optional cable lengths to 500' (WLEXC). The Water Level Logger's datalogger is housed in a weatherproof cylindrical enclosure which slips inside a 2 inch pipe. The Logger is easily adapted with standard hardware for well head mounting or other installations. The internal 9 VDC battery powers the logger and sensor for one year. EZ-PC software allows simple upload of the Logger's ASCII spreadsheet format data to standard spreadsheets on a PC computer. The Water Level Logger's level sensor is fully encapsulated with marine-grade epoxy. The electronics are encased in epoxy so that moisture can never leak in through the O-ring seals or work its way down the vent tube to cause drift or sensor failure (as is the case with other sensors). The vent tube is sealed directly to the sensing element, and any moisture that may enter the vent tube only comes in contact with ceramic, not the electronics. The submersible pressure transducer uses a unique silicon diaphragm to interface between the water and the sensing element. This silicon diaphragm is highly flexible and touches the sensing element, producing a sensor with exceptional linearity and very low hysteresis. The pressure transducer utilizes a stainless steel micro-screen cap to protect the sensing element. This protective cap has hundreds of openings, making fouling the sensor with silt, mud or sludge virtually impossible. Installation and Applications The Water Level Logger's pressure sensor may be placed slightly below the lowest expected water level. When ordering, select the sensor range that will cover the maximum water level change (this is not necessarily the total depth of water). Select the smallest water level range possible to ensure greatest accuracy. The Water Level Logger has a cylindrical enclosure that is designed to slide into a 2 inch PVC pipe. For monitoring groundwater, the sensor can be installed in a PVC pipe with its lip resting on the top of the pipe. For monitoring surface water, a protective stilling well can be constructed of PVC pipe with several holes near the bottom to allow water to flow through the pipe and reach the sensor. The pipe may be attached vertically to a post, or on a slant down the bank. Water Level Loggers are useful in the following applications: groundwater monitoring, surface water monitoring, sewer flow monitoring, stormwater studies, streamflow monitoring, infiltration/inflow studies, pump tests, and much more...
